What Key Features Define a High-Quality Queen Mattress Under $500?

High-quality queen mattresses under $500 typically feature supportive materials, comfort layers, durability, and specific attributes that cater to different sleeping styles.

  1. Support System
  2. Comfort Layer
  3. Durability
  4. Mattress Type
  5. Edge Support
  6. Motion Isolation

Support System:
The support system provides the underlying structure of the mattress. A high-quality queen mattress under $500 often includes innerspring coils or foam layers that offer stability and spinal alignment. Innerspring mattresses vary in coil count and gauge, with a higher coil count typically providing better support. Memory foam mattresses use dense foam for pressure relief, ensuring comfort for side sleepers.

Comfort Layer:
The comfort layer directly affects the feel of the mattress. High-quality options often use materials like memory foam, latex, or gel-infused foams. Memory foam contours to the body, while latex tends to be more responsive. Gel-infused foam can help with temperature regulation. A study by the National Sleep Foundation shows that a comfortable mattress significantly improves sleep quality, emphasizing the importance of this layer.

Durability:
Durability refers to the mattress’s ability to withstand daily use. Quality materials, such as high-density foams or steel coils, contribute to a longer lifespan. Many mattresses in this price range offer warranties that cover manufacturing defects, but lower-quality materials may lead to sagging over time. Research indicates that mattresses should last 7-10 years under normal conditions.

Mattress Type:
Different mattress types cater to various preferences. Innerspring mattresses are known for their bounce and coolness, while foam mattresses excel in pressure relief and motion isolation. Hybrid mattresses combine elements from both types, appealing to a broader audience. Consumer reports show that hybrid models have gained popularity for offering balanced support and comfort.

Edge Support:
Edge support refers to how well the mattress maintains its structure along the perimeter. Good edge support prevents sagging when sitting or lying near the edge. This feature can be crucial for couples sharing a queen mattress. Models with reinforced edges or firmer foam offers better support, allowing greater usable mattress surface without feeling like you’re going to roll off.

Motion Isolation:
Motion isolation measures how well the mattress absorbs movement. This is especially important for couples, as it minimizes disturbances during the night. Memory foam offers superior motion isolation compared to innerspring models. A study from the Sleep Foundation highlighted that individuals sharing a bed should consider this feature to improve sleep quality for both partners.

How Does Each Mattress Perform in Terms of Support and Durability?

Each mattress performs differently in terms of support and durability. Support refers to how well a mattress maintains spinal alignment and provides comfort. Durability indicates how long a mattress lasts without sagging or losing its supportive qualities.

Memory foam mattresses offer excellent support. They contour to the body and relieve pressure points. However, their durability can vary based on quality. High-density memory foam lasts longer than lower-density options.

Innerspring mattresses provide robust support due to their coil systems. They offer strong edge support and responsiveness. Their durability mainly depends on coil gauge and overall construction. Thicker coils generally enhance durability.

Latex mattresses provide strong and consistent support. They maintain their shape over time and offer good pressure relief. Natural latex is more durable than synthetic options.

Hybrid mattresses combine the features of memory foam and innerspring. They provide balanced support and good durability when made with high-quality materials. The performance depends on the specific materials used in construction.

Overall, the support and durability of mattresses can vary widely based on their materials and construction methods. Evaluating these characteristics is essential for making an informed choice.
